Effective management of external cervical resorption (ECR) depends on accurate assessment of the true † external repair of the resorptive defect endodon-tic treatment, Objective: The purpose of this study was to carry out a clinical evaluation of the treatment of invasive cervical resorption. Method and materials: Topical application of a 90% aqueous solution of trichloracetic acid, curettage, nonsurgical root canal treatment where necessary, and restoration with glass-ionomer cement were performed on 94 patients with a total of 101 affected teeth. External Resorption. External root resorption is may be more difficult to treat. For these defects, the blood supply to the resorbing cells is in the external periodontium. As with internal root resorption, the blood supply to the resorbing cells must be cut off first, and then a biologically acceptable restorative material placed afterwards.

The exact etiology of external cervical resorption is not fully understood, but several predisposing factors have been suggested, including: orthodontic forces, trauma, intracoronal bleaching, surgical procedures, periodontal therapy, bruxism, intracoronal restorations, developmental defects, systemic diseases. 3.

The effects of external (cervical) resorption (ECR), which you seem to be describing, occur near the gum line at the cervical (“neck-like”) region of a tooth. In its early stages, this condition may produce pink spots where the enamel is undermined and filled with the pinkish cells that do the damage. In time, these spots progress to cavity-like areas. Resorption (breakdown) and deposition (adding to) are normal processes by which the body maintains balance.
